James A. Lane was a research associate at the University of Chicago’s Metallurgical Laboratory (“Met Lab”) during the Manhattan Project.
Louis Fasulo worked at Los Alamos for nine years, beginning in 1943. In 1952, he began a 31 year long career with the Rocky Flats nuclear weapons plant.
Ruth DeWire accompanied her husband, physicist John DeWire, to Los Alamos during the Manhattan Project.
